Transaction 30a6126e68fd73edf24d40ec6bc56237abc80eff78a4af80a3c48e6b87eaaef6
1 Input
1 Output
-
30a6126e68fd73edf24d40ec6bc56237abc80eff78a4af80a3c48e6b87eaaef6:0
- value
- 188038
- script pubkey
- OP_0 OP_PUSHBYTES_20 b1af7afb19421d864abb3b5d5841a6ee5b984ab0
- address
- bc1qkxhh47ceggwcvj4m8dw4ssdxaedesj4snq72gv